Steel Cable.

Our recommended cable for most applications is 1x19 construction, type 316 stainless steel cable.

Other constructions of cable can be used, such as 7x7 or 7x19, but they are rarely recommended.

Cable Construction Type 316 Stainless Steel is used, unless otherwise specified. Type 316 has better corrosion resistance to most chemicals, salts and acids and is more resistant to marine atmosphere because of an addition of 2.0 to 3.0% molybdenum. This addition improves the corrosion resistance of austenitic steels and imparts hot strength characteristics. Another valuable property of Type 316 is high creep strength at elevated temperatures. Fabrication characteristics of Type 316 are similar to Type 302 or 304Type 316 is a higher grade of steel that is rust resistant
 
Cable Construction
1 x 19
Cable
Very rigid. Lowest stretching under load. 1 x 19 is the preferred construction for cable railings, under most circumstances.
7 x 7
Cable
Less rigid than 1x19.
7 x 19
7 x 19 cable
Less rigid than 7x7.
*1/8" diameter cable can be vulnerable to failure under shock loads caused by abuse, such as a heavy person applying an out of plane load on a properly tensioned cable. 3/16" and larger cable diameters have significantly higher load ratings than 1/8" and are, therefore, not as susceptible to failure as 1/8".

PL-4 (1/8th in) and PL-6 (3/16th in). Push-Lock™ fittings are designed for use with 1x19 L.H. lay strand only. They can be used with any tensioning device on the other end… but when used with our swageless tensioners, both ends can be put on the cable by hand without any swaging or special tools.

The PL-4 and PL-6 Push-Lock™ fittings (with rounded heads) are used on level runs. They rest in a hole in the end post. When used with an end post 1-1/2” or more in thickness, the Push-Lock™ fitting with a rounded head is hidden inside the end post, with only the head exposed on the outside of the post. Pipe ends are counterbored, so the full perimeter of the head will rest on a flat surface in the pipe. A plastic washer is included and acts as a scratch resistant barrier between the Push-Lock™ fitting and a metal post. The head rests on the outside wall of a flat-sided metal post or on a stainless steel washer on a wooden post. For wood applications, also order 7-16SAE washer.
